Amy Adams’ daughter Aviana Le Gallo may be eyeing a career behind the camera.
The actress revealed that the 16-year-old is interested in pursuing a career in production.
“I think I know what she’s going to do,” the six-time Oscar nominee told People magazine on July 21 when asked about her daughter’s aspirations.
“I know she’s interested in production in general, so I’d like to see what path she chooses to focus on,” she added.
The “Enchanted” star has largely kept her only child out of the spotlight, but the mother-daughter duo made a rare appearance at Paris Fashion Week in March.
For the outing, Aviana paired a green turtleneck with a black maxi skirt, while her mother wore an all-black ensemble, from a leather jacket to wide-leg pants.
Adams shares Aviana with her husband Darren Le Gallo, whom she met in an acting class in 2001.
The couple welcomed Aviana in 2010 and walked down the aisle in California five years later.
She grew up hiding from the public eye and made her red carpet debut alongside her parents at the Toronto International Film Festival in September 2024.
At the time, Adams revealed that her daughter was not aiming for a career in Hollywood.
“[Acting]is not her current plan,” the Golden Globe winner told E! News on the carpet. “She really wants another path.”
However, the “Woman in the Window” actress did not exclude the possibility that her daughter would change her mind someday.
“I understand, but I never say never,” she continued. “Whatever she wants to do, I will support her.”
